[Bug 985202] Re: libx11 causes kwin to crash on login (over NX protocol)

2013-01-03 Thread Gareth Clay
Reinhard, thanks for your excellent workaround - this seems far less
intrusive than downgrading libs.

In case it helps anyone else, after a bit of searching I found the file
to change to add the nxagent command line arg to a plain NoMachine NX
install.

The file is /usr/NX/etc/node.cfg. The property to modify is
AgentExtraOptions.
